Tejun Heo wrote:
With hotplug, PHY always needs to be debounced before a reset as any
reset might find new devices.  Extract PHY waiting code from
sata_phy_resume() and extend it to include SStatus debouncing.  Note
that sata_phy_debounce() is superset of what used to be done inside
sata_phy_resume().

Three default debounce timing parameters are defined to be used by
hot/boot plug.  As resume failure during probing will be properly
handled as errors, timeout doesn't have to be long as before.
probeinit() uses the same timeout to retain the original behavior.

+/**
+ *	sata_phy_debounce - debounce SATA phy status
+ *	@ap: ATA port to debounce SATA phy status for
+ *	@params: timing parameters { interval, duratinon, timeout } in msec
+ *
+ *	Make sure SStatus of @ap reaches stable state, determined by
+ *	holding the same value where DET is not 1 for @duration polled
+ *	every @interval, before @timeout.  Timeout constraints the
+ *	beginning of the stable state.  Because, after hot unplugging,
+ *	DET gets stuck at 1 on some controllers, this functions waits
+ *	until timeout then returns 0 if DET is stable at 1.
+ *
+ *	LOCKING:
+ *	Kernel thread context (may sleep)
+ *
+ *	RETURNS:
+ *	0 on success, -errno on failure.
+ */

NAK, changes behavior. We want to preserve the old order of operations because some PHYs (sata_via and sata_mv come to mind) are a bit sensitive to being pounded immediately after wakeup.
